Transaction af28de8f94b7f117e6760e40c65e7c06306614ceb5d908dfc9ae1db322942389
1 Input
1 Output
-
af28de8f94b7f117e6760e40c65e7c06306614ceb5d908dfc9ae1db322942389:0
- value
- 45316371
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a016a84ab12c5794fcd1da8f66c2b0288d2018d
- address
- bc1qlgqk4p9tztzhjn7drk50vmptq2ydyqvdskq89t